<h1>NaBFID and New Development Bank partner to finance infrastructure projects for clean energy and transportation</h1> The National Bank for Financing Infrastructure and Development (NaBFID) has signed a Memorandum of Understanding with the New Development Bank (NDB) to establish a strategic framework for cooperation in infrastructure financing. The partnership aims to bridge financing gaps and explore long-term collaboration opportunities, including technical expertise exchange. Both institutions will focus on clean energy, transportation, sustainable water management, and other infrastructure projects. They will also collaborate on research and capacity-building initiatives through seminars and workshops. NDB, established by BRICS nations, has committed USD 35.6 billion for 108 projects since 2015, while NaBFID was established in April 2021 to accelerate India's infrastructure development.
